    In this paper a new cosmological solution to the five-dimensional Einstein gravity modified with the Gauss-Bonnet term is obtained. The Gauss-Bonnet term is the unique combination in five dimensions that results in second order field equations and is given in terms of the squares of the Ricci scalar, the Ricci tensor and the Riemann tensor. The metric ansatz of the solution is inspired by the braneworld cosmology models which attracted a lot of attention in recent years. In these models, the observable universe is a four dimensional hypersurface (brane) embedded in a higher dimensional spacetime. Here, the induced metric on the brane is chosen as the flat Friedmann-Lemaitre-Robertson-Walker spacetime. As for the energy momentum tensor, it is assumed that five dimensional bulk spacetime is empty and the brane contributes as dust whose effect becomes negligible in an expanding universe. Then, it is shown that under these conditions the four dimensional part is described by the de Sitter geometry.
